You can save 5% by being present the day of the sale.
Once the property is sold at the Union County courthouse,
you only have ten days to make an upset bid.
The upset bid must be 5% above the auction bid.
You must plan to get a lawyer to make a complete title check
before you actually purchase the foreclosure.
Eleven days after the sale date, it is too late.
The foreclosure belongs to someone else at that point.
When placing your bid you do have to turn in a deposit
to the Union County courthouse of 5% of the bid price.
After placing a bid, there is a 10 day waiting period
to make sure nobody upsets your bid.
